King's Pawn is a dark mafia romance between two men who really shouldn't fall for each other, but can't seem to resist temptation. An enemies-to-lovers, grumpy-sunshine, age-gap, hate-f*ck, capture kink, touch-him-and-die (literally) novella.

I struggle with novellas, and that’s a “me” problem. Too often, I find them to be too short to really get involved in the plot or care deeply about the characters. I also find that in this particular case, the story started out great, it was engaging, intriguing, and complex, and then it’s as if the author realized that she only had 30 pages left and the last part felt rushed and underdeveloped. It was also harder in that case because this novella is not connected to another book, so the author had to introduce completely new characters, flesh them out, and tell their story in less than 100 pages.

Honestly, with all the ideas and the complexity we saw in only a few chapters, there was potential here to write a whole novel about Killian and Noah, instead of a too-short novella. Because of the shortness of the book, the romance does not truly have time to develop, so we go from Noah not really caring about Killian, but finding him very attractive, and Killian being secretly attracted to Noah too, to them giving in to their urges, having spicy and kinky sex, and then in the epilogue it almost felt like insta-love because we didn’t spend nearly enough time with them to appreciate the development f their feelings and building of their relationship. But again, this might have more to do with my struggle with novellas and short stories.

This is not my favorite book from Ariana Nash, but it is fast-paced, engaging, sexy, and a fun quick read. I recommend giving it a try if you are looking for a spicy (and kinky) novella with a mafia vibe.

Ariana Nash entered the mafia romance space with her Forgive Me series, and hopefully this novella is an indication that she has decided to stay. Not as angsty or tragic as Forgive Me, there's a flair of the playfulness that defines her SOS Hotel series. It's doesn't rise to that level of silliness, but there's a bit more fun mixed in here than her darker stories.

Noah King is the maligned son of one of Boston's most powerful mob families. Killian is his father's enforcer and hitman, who has been barging in to cart Noah away from his bad choices for the past five years. But this time, he's come to execute Noah for a betrayal he didn't commit. Lucky for Noah, Killian can't bring himself to pull the trigger, so now they have to figure out how to keep Noah alive without getting Killian killed for disobeying orders. And the cabin they're hiding out in gives them no room to hide their mutual secret attraction.

It's only a novella, so there's not a lot of page time to do deep development of character, but there's enough on the page to get a decent feel for both Noah and Killian as well as the general stakes and mild mafia storyline happening in the background. That being said, there is plenty of time for some incredible dirty sex -- I wasn't expecting it, given the page count, but I am here for it! Noah is sassy and Killian is a honed beast that once unleashed gives Noah the time of his life, and then some. Killian's intensity and one-minded focus isn't limited to mafia business, it's how he views relationships, too.

I don't want to say more, but this was a quick, sexy read with space for more exploration of this world and of Noah and Killian's future. I hope Ariana Nash sticks around in this world.
